Speedrack Midwest: frequently asked questions

Is Speedrack Midwest's water safe to drink?

Speedrack Midwest is an active transient non-community water system regulated under the Safe Drinking Water Act, overseen by the MI state drinking water program. EPA SDWA violation and enforcement records for this system are being added to AquaCensus from EPA ECHO; consult EPA ECHO or your annual Consumer Confidence Report for its current compliance status.

Who runs Speedrack Midwest?

Speedrack Midwest (PWSID MI2100141) is a private-owned transient non-community water system, regulated by the MI state drinking water program.

How many people does Speedrack Midwest serve?

Speedrack Midwest reports serving 30 people through 1 service connections in Kent County, Michigan.

Where does Speedrack Midwest get its water?

EPA SDWIS lists this system's primary water source as groundwater.
